Forged Steel Ball Valves are available in two types: Two-Piece Split Body and Three-Piece Bolted Body. The forging material ensures sufficient rigidity and strength under the maximum rated operating pressure, eliminating the inherent flaws associated with casting. The thick walls of the separate bodies and the use of high-strength tie bolts facilitate valve maintenance and provide adequate support to withstand pipeline stress. The internal components of the valve are meticulously designed and selected to ensure reliability under various working conditions.
Technical Specification
» Size Range: 1/2-2 Inch (DN15-DN50) (for Forged Items)
» Design Pressure: Class 150-900 LB (PN10-PN160)
» Materials:
Carbon Steel, Alloy Steel, Stainless Steel, Duplex Steel, etc
ASTM A105N, A350 LF2, A182 F11, F22, F304, F304L, F316, F316L
» Trim Materials: 13%Cr, ASTM A182 F11, F22, SS 304, SS 304L, SS 316, SS 316L, and other specials
» Seat Materials: PTFE, RPTFE, PEEK
» End Connections: BW, RF, Grooved
» Design and Manufacture: API 608, BS 5351, ASME B16.34
» Face to Face (End to End): ANSI B16.10
» Flanged Connection: ANSI B16.5
» Test and Inspection: API 598, API 6D
